The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Henry Stevens, born in 1824 in Guildford, Surrey, consisted of 7 members. Henry was the head of the household, married to Jane Stevens, born in 1849 in Guildford, Surrey, England. They had 5 children; Robert (born 1867 in City of London, Middlesex, England), Jane (born 1868 in City of London, Middlesex, England), Anne (born 1869 in City of London, Middlesex, England), Maud (born 1879 in City of London, Middlesex, England) and Ada (born 1881 in City of London, Middlesex, England).
